‘NCIS’ Season 9 Episode 15 Preview: Tony Bumps Into Ex-Fiancee

After being pictured as a married man in the 200th episode of “NCIS: Naval Criminal Investigative Service” which explored alt realities, Tony is going to reunite with a woman who could have been his wife in real world in next week’s episode. His ex-fiancee Wendy Miller, who has been mentioned before on the show, will make an appearance since the team needs her help to solve a case.

The NCIS team will also uncover a secret society consisting of real-life superheroes when investigating the murder of a Navy captain who is found dead and dressed in a weird costume under his uniform. While working together to track down the villain, Tony and Wendy may explore their past romance as they are seen passionately kissing in a preview for the said outing.

Titled “Secrets“, the upcoming episode of the police procedural series will air on Valentine’s Day or Tuesday, February 14 at 8/7c on CBS. Former “Entourage” star Perrey Reeves will guest star as Wendy.

‘House M.D.’ Producers Make ‘Painful’ Decision to End Show After Current Season

It’s official; “House M.D.” will call it quits after this season. On Wednesday, February 8, FOX announced that the currently airing eighth season will be the last for the long-running medical drama.

“The decision to end the show now, or ever, is a painful one, as it risks putting asunder hundreds of close friendships that have developed over the last eight years,” star Hugh Laurie as well as executive producers David Shore and Katie Jacobs said in a joint statement, “but also because the show itself has been a source of great pride to everyone involved.”

“The producers have always imagined House as an enigmatic creature; he should never be the last one to leave the party. How much better to disappear before the music stops, while there is still some promise and mystique in the air,” they added.

After thanking fans and everyone involved in the making of “House”, they noted, “So, finally, everyone at House will bid farewell to the audience and to each other with more than a few tears, but also with a deep feeling of gratitude for the grand adventure they have been privileged to enjoy for the last eight years. If the show lives on somewhere, with somebody, as a fond memory, then that is a precious feat, of which we will always be proud.”

FOX entertainment president Kevin Reilly released another statement to say, “While it’s with much regret, and a lump in our throats, we respect the decision Hugh, David and Katie have made.” He added, “We wholeheartedly thank them [the 'House' team], and the fans who have supported the show.”

The eighth season finale which will also be the series finale will be shot in April and is currently scheduled to air in May. Some familiar faces may grace the show once again before it bids farewell since creator David Shore once said he wanted former leading lady Lisa Edelstein to return, while Jennifer Morrison has recently expressed her willingness to reprise her role as Cameron.

‘Survivor: South Pacific’ Finale: Who Won?

Just like last year, this season of “Survivor” ended up being all about a popular returning player. Like Boston Rob, Coach Wade dominated the game and never seemed in any jeopardy. It was often his vote that determined who would survive and who would go home. But, unlike Rob, Coach was not able to translate that domination and power into a victory.

Instead, Sophie, one of the strongest female competitors in “Survivor” history, managed to win over a jury that thought she was standoffish and distant. In the end, they had to respect ability to compete with the guys in challenges as well as her strategy of who to sit next to at the end. It also probably helped that she shed some pretty genuine tears and seemed to genuinely feel bad about some of what she had done during the game. She and Coach both seemed to play the jury well, especially Coach who appeared to have nothing but enemies on the panel but seemed to win some respect with a fit of real honesty at the end. Albert, the third finalist, was never a contender. His plan to be a friend to all was too transparent and he instead seemed to be a friend to none. Several jury members really seemed to agonize over their votes. Sophie may have beaten Coach 6-3, but the margin may not have reflected how close a competition this was.

You cannot talk about this season without talking about super-”Survivor” Ozzy. Eight people tried to defeat him on Redemption Island… all failed. He got within a whisker of making the finals, and clearly would have won the jury vote in a landslide, but finally lost a challenge and was voted out. The fact that it was Sophie who defeated him probably carried some weight with a jury that wanted to vote for Ozzy, but could not. Sophie was the next best thing, and it made her a million dollars.

All in all, it was a good season of “Survivor.” The contestants seemed to figure out that Redemption Island could be a strategic part of the game and the fans seemed to embrace Redemption more than a season ago when it caused a bit of a fan backlash. After consecutive seasons where returning players, folks who have been on “Survivor” before, have dominated, perhaps it is time for Survivor to again try a field of newbies.
